It seems that K-pop fans have noticed Philippines' Department of Health (DOH) public advetisement campaign jingle and f(x)'s "Rum Pum Pum Pum" comparison, boiling down to the issue of plagiarism. Due to this, SM Entertainment, home of the girl group f(x) has made their move and have called out the attention of the DOH in this act of plagiarism.
On December 8, a representative of the agency told news outlets No Cut News and My Daily, "By no means have we permitted the use of the music, 'Rum Pum Pum Pum.' The original publisher of 'Rum Pum Pum Pum' confirmed that the music used by the Philippines' public service campaign in question is indeed plagiarism, so we already started taking action."
K-pop fans and netizens are alarmed with this since the music has been used for campaign against teenage pregnancy, making it controversial.
